A solar hydrogen system that co-generates heat and oxygen

Hydrogen production from water using solar energy is referred to as artificial photosynthesis, but the LRESE system is unique for its ability to also produce heat and oxygen at scale. After the dish concentrates the sun''s rays, water is pumped into its focus spot, where an integrated photoelectrochemical reactor is housed.
